Mainos

Vadelma Pi: n käyttö on hauskaa. Koska valittavana on niin paljon projekteja, 50 dollarin tietokone pitää sinut kiireisenä kuukausien ajan. Mutta Raspberry Pi -sovelluksen asettaminen voi olla aikaa vievää.

Jos et ole kytkemässä näppäimistöä määrittääksesi Wi-Fi-yhteyden, yrität löytää oikeat näyttöasetukset. Tai jokin muu triviaalinen asennusvaihtoehto, jonka ei pitäisi todella kestää kauan selvittääkseen.

Mutta monissa tapauksissa voit tehdä nämä muutokset helposti ja nopeasti. Näin voit muuttaa Raspberry Pi -sovelluksen / boot / osioon, ennen kuin edes käynnistät sen.

Mikä on Vadelma Pi-käynnistysosio?

Vadelma Pi 2

Kun määrität Raspberry Pi -sovelluksen, sinun on asennettava käyttöjärjestelmä. Tätä ei tehdä samalla tavalla kuin tietokoneessa tai kannettavassa tietokoneessa. Sen sijaan käyttöjärjestelmä on asennettu Raspberry Pi -sovellukseen Kuinka asentaa käyttöjärjestelmä Raspberry Pi -sovellukseenTässä on ohjeet kuinka asentaa käyttöjärjestelmä Raspberry Pi -sovellukseen ja miten kloonata täydellinen asennus nopeasti nopeaan palautukseen. Lue lisää kirjoittamalla se SD-kortille.

Tämän prosessin aikana kortti jaetaan kahteen tai useampaan osioon. Yhdessä näistä on käyttöjärjestelmä, joka on alustettu EXT4-tiedostojärjestelmällä.

Toista kutsutaan aina “boot” ja kutsutaan / boot /. Siinä on joukko käynnistystietoja, kokoonpanoja ja muita vaihtoehtoja, ja se on alustettu FAT-tiedostojärjestelmällä. Huomaa, että / boot / osio vaaditaan jokaisessa Raspberry Pi-distrossa.

Sen lisäksi, että voit käyttää / boot / muokata Raspberry Pi -laitteistoasetuksia, se on huomattava toisella tavalla. / Boot / osioon pääsee mistä tahansa tietokoneesta, jolla on kortinlukija. Tämä on ristiriidassa pääkäyttöjärjestelmän kanssa, jota voidaan melkein aina lukea vain Linux-tietokoneella.

Sinänsä voit käyttää / käynnistää / Windowsissa, macOSissa, Linuxissa, mitä tahansa. Tärkeää on, että voit selata sitä myös Raspberry Pi -sovelluksen asennetusta käyttöjärjestelmästä.

Joten / boot / osio on hyödyllinen. Mutta mitä voit tehdä sillä? Aseta Raspberry Pi-SD-kortti tietokoneeseesi, avaa / käynnistä / ja lue sitten sitten saadaksesi selville.

1. Merkitse Raspberry Pi Distro

Useiden projektien ajaminen Raspberry Pi -laitteellasi voi olla hieman hämmentävää. Ylläpidän esimerkiksi laskentataulukoita, joten tiedän mitä jokainen Pi tekee. Huomautan myös, mikä laitteisto on kytketty, kuten kamera tai kosketusnäyttö, ja missä tapauksessa Pi on siinä.

Mutta sinulla voi olla vain yksi Pi, jossa on useita microSD-kortteja projektien välisen vaihtamisen helpoksi. Silloinkin voi kuitenkin olla vaikea muistaa mitä kortteja on.

Luo vain tekstitiedosto hakemistoon / boot / osio hyödyllisellä nimellä, kuten “security cam.txt” tai “print server.txt”. Voit lisätä lisätietoja projektista tiedoston runkoon.

Tämän avulla voit tunnistaa SD-kortin nopeasti käynnistämättä.

2. Säädä Config.txt-tiedostoa parempaan laitteistoyhteensopivuuteen

Vaikka Raspberry Pi: llä ei ole sellaista järjestelmän BIOS: ää, siinä on config.txt-tiedosto, joka löytyy hakemistosta / boot /.

Tämä on Raspberry Pi: n säätöpaikka, jossa on vaihtoehtoja melkein kaikkeen mitä voit kuvitella. Tiedostossa on luettelo asetuksista käyttäen muotoa “ominaisuus = arvo” (ilman lainausmerkkejä), yksi riviä kohti. Huomaa välilyönti. Kommentit voidaan lisätä käyttämällä riviä # -merkin avulla.

Jokainen config.txt-tiedoston osa on selvästi merkitty, ja kommentoiduilla riveillä selitetään, mitä kukin asetus tekee. Vaikka tätä tiedostoa tulisi muokata vain huolellisesti, on tarpeeksi tietoa, jotta voit estää muutoksia tekemästä vakavia seurauksia.

Täällä tekemäsi tyypit riippuvat laitteistoasetuksista. Voit esimerkiksi ottaa kameramoduulin käyttöön käynnistyksen yhteydessä:

start_x = 1

Sillä välin, jos yrität saada kuvaa HDMI-ulostulon kautta, käytä

hdmi_safe = 1

Tämä asetus yhdistää useita HDMI-asetuksia luodakseen yleisen, kattava ratkaisun, jonka pitäisi pakottaa HDMI toimimaan.

Vielä yksi huomattava config.txt-nipistin on näytön kiertäminen näyttö_rotate-sovelluksella. Kierrä esimerkiksi 90 astetta

display_rotate = 1

Sillä välin on 180 asteen kierto

display_rotate = 2

Ja niin edelleen.

Kuten olette keränneet, config.txt on Raspberry-laitteen tärkein laitteiston kokoonpano-ominaisuus Pi. Vaikka raspi-config on merkittävä, config.txt: llä on suurempi vaikutus, mikä mahdollistaa huomattavan esikäynnistyksen kokoonpano.

Ota yhteys elinux.org wiki saadaksesi kattavampia tietoja config.txt-tiedostosta.

3. Luo tyhjä tiedosto SSH: n käyttöönottamiseksi

Muokkaa config.txt-tiedostoa Raspberry Pi -sovelluksessa

SSH: n käyttö Raspberry Pi: n etäkäyttöön säästää paljon aikaa. Voit esimerkiksi päivittää käyttöjärjestelmän, mutta et pysty yhdistämään Pi: tä televisioon. Vastaus on etäyhteydessä Raspberry Pi -laitteeseesi VNC, SSH ja HDMI: kolme vaihtoehtoa vadelma-pi katsomiseenRaspberry Pi on huomattava pieni tietokone, mutta sen asentaminen ja liittäminen näytölle voi viedä paljon aikaa. Lue lisää ja SSH on nopein tapa tehdä tämä.

Debian-pohjaisen Raspberry Pi-käyttöjärjestelmän myöhemmissä versioissa on kuitenkin SSH poistettu käytöstä oletuksena. Tämä on turvatoimenpide, joka voi osoittautua haitalliseksi tavallisille käyttäjille.

On kuitenkin kiertotapa. Luo vain erityinen tiedosto hakemistoon / boot / osio, jotta SSH otetaan käyttöön.

Avaa / boot / osio tietokoneellasi ja luo uusi tiedosto. Merkitse se ssh ja poista tiedostopääte. Se on niin yksinkertaista! Niin nopeasti kuin se voi olla, on syytä pitää ssh-liputiedosto tietokoneellasi. Tällä tavalla sinun tarvitsee vain vetää ja pudottaa tiedosto / boot / osioon joka kerta, kun asennat Raspberry Pi-käyttöjärjestelmän.

Tämä tiedosto toimii lipuna, kun Pi käynnistyy, käskeen käyttöjärjestelmän sallimaan SSH: n.

Huomaa, että sinua pyydetään vaihtamaan oletusarvoinen “pi” -salasana ensimmäisen kirjautumisen yhteydessä.

4. Tallenna Wi-Fi-verkon käyttöoikeustiedot hakemistoon wpa_supplicant.conf

Toinen aika Raspberry Pi -sovelluksen asettamisessa on saada laite langattomaan verkkoosi. Vaikka liität sen suoraan reitittimeen, voit säästää aikaa täällä, portteja ei ehkä ole tarpeeksi. Tai olet, että Pi sijaitsee liian kaukana.

Vastaus on langaton verkko, mikä tarkoittaa kirjautumista Pi: n työpöytäympäristöön. Asennus hiirellä ja näppäimistöllä ei vie liian kauan. Voit asettaa sen komentoriville muokkaamalla wpa_supplicant.conf-tiedostoa, mutta voit myös muokata tätä ennen Pi-käynnistyksiä.

Luo / boot / osioon uusi tiedosto wpa_supplicant.conf. Avaa se tietokoneesi tekstieditorissa (esim. Notepad Windows-käyttöjärjestelmässä, tai voit mieluummin Notepad ++). Kopioi ja liitä seuraavat rivit:

ctrl_interface = DIR = / var / run / wpa_supplicant GROUP = netdev update_config = 1 maa = Yhdysvaltain verkko = {ssid = "SSID" psk = "SALASANA" key_mgmt = WPA-PSK}

Jotkut muokkaukset vaaditaan. Vaihda ensin maa sopivaksi (esimerkiksi Ison-Britannian GB).

Aseta tämän jälkeen SSID- ja SALASANA-kentät vastaamaan langattoman verkon kenttiä. Tallenna tiedosto, sulje se ja käynnistä Pi. Laitteen pitäisi pian muodostaa yhteys paikalliseen Wi-Fi-verkkoon. Siirry reitittimen hallintasivulle nähdäksesi Pi: n IP-osoitteen.

Sinun pitäisi sitten päästä etäyhteyteen Raspberry Pi: hen SSH: n kautta. Kuten ssh, kannattaa pitää kopio wpa_supplicant.conf-tiedostosta tietokoneellasi nopeaa asennusta varten.

5. Korjaa virheet / boot / osiossa

USB-portit Raspberry Pi 4 -laitteessa

Raspberry Pi 4: n julkaisu vuonna 2019 esitti kolme iteraatiota erilaisilla RAM-määrityksillä. Vaikka 1 Gt: n ja 2 Gt: n mallit toimivat hyvin, 4 Gt: n Raspberry Pi 4: ssä on virhe. Erityisesti tämä koskee USB-porttintunnistusta Ubuntussa.

Vika estää porttien havaitsemisen Pi 4: n 4 Gt: n versiossa, mutta kiertotapa on olemassa. Ennen kuin virallinen korjaus otetaan käyttöön, voit säätää käyttöjärjestelmän käytettävissä olevan RAM-muistin määrää.

Avaa / boot / firmware ja etsi usercfg.txt-tiedosto. Käynnistä tämä tekstieditorissa ja lisää:

total_mem = 3072

Tämä muuttaa käytettävissä olevan RAM-muistin 4 Gt: stä 3 Gt: ksi.

Tallenna tiedosto ja sulje ja käynnistä sitten Raspberry Pi 4. USB-porttien pitäisi nyt toimia. Tulevan päivityksen pitäisi ratkaista tämä vika, joten muista poistaa rivi käyttäjäncfg.txt-tiedostosta, kun näin tapahtuu.

6. Kopioi tiedot tietokoneeltasi Raspberry Pi -sovellukseen

Jos joudut kopioimaan tietoja nopeasti tietokoneeltasi Raspberry Pi -sovellukseen, voit käyttää / boot / osiota. Kopioi vain tiedot uuteen hakemistoon, ja ne ovat käytettävissä, kun käynnistät Pi: n. Huomaa, että / boot / osion koko on kuitenkin rajoitettu.

Sellaisena se soveltuu vain pienille tiedostoille, kuten MP3-tiedostoille tai kuville, videotiedostojen sijasta. Se ei ole ihanteellinen ratkaisu, mutta toimii.

Tässä on lisää tapoja kopioi tiedot tietokoneen ja Raspberry Pi: n välillä 5 tapaa kopioida tietoja Raspberry Pi -laitteesta tietokoneelleJossain vaiheessa haluatte helpon tavan saada tiedot Pi-laitteen SD-kortilta tietokoneesi kiintolevylle. Tämä voi olla hankala. Lue lisää .

6 tapaa käyttää Raspberry Pi / boot / partition -sovellusta

Koska niin paljon vaihtoehtoja Raspberry Pi -sovelluksen määrittämiseen hakemistossa / boot / osio, säästät aikaa seuraavaan projektiisi. Käännä uudelleen tekemällä seuraavat toimet / boot / osiossa:

  • Merkitse SD-kortti
  • Säädä config.txt
  • Ota SSH käyttöön
  • Lataa langattoman verkon käyttöoikeustiedot etukäteen
  • Korjaa virheet
  • Kopioi tiedot tietokoneelta Pi: lle

Monet näistä hienosäädöistä nopeuttavat asioita, mutta voit tehostaa Raspberry Pi -asetuksiasi. Säästä aikaa seuraavasti Raspberry Pi -sovelluksen määrittäminen PiBakeryn avulla Määritä Vadelma Pi -asennus PiBakeryn avullaEntä jos voisit määrittää Raspbianin ennen kuin aloitat Raspberry Pi: n? Eikö olisi hienoa, että langaton verkko olisi asetettu, jotta se toimii oikein ilman pakkausta? Tässä on miten. Lue lisää .

Christian Cawley on varatoimittaja turvallisuuteen, Linuxiin, itsehoitoon, ohjelmointiin ja teknisiin selityksiin. Hän tuottaa myös The Really Useful Podcastin ja hänellä on laaja kokemus työpöydän ja ohjelmistojen tuesta. Linux Format -lehden avustaja Christian on Vadelma Pi-tinkerer, Lego-rakastaja ja retro-fani.